Watch Out for Mold and Mildew
Mold and mildew love damp and shady spots. If they take over, they can weaken your pergola and make it look ugly. To prevent this, make sure your pergola gets enough sunlight and airflow.
- Trim any overgrown plants or vines that block air circulation.
- If you see mold, mix equal parts of vinegar and water and scrub it off.
- For wooden pergolas, avoid too much moisture, as it can lead to rot.
By keeping mold and mildew under control, you ensure your pergola stays strong and beautiful.
Protect the Wood
If your pergola is made of wood, it needs extra care. Wood can crack, fade, or rot over time if left untreated. The best way to protect it is by sealing or staining it.
- Apply a waterproof sealant every one or two years.
- Stain or paint it to prevent sun and water damage.
- Check for cracks or splinters and sand them down before they get worse.
With the right protection, your wooden pergola will stand the test of time.

Keep It Bug-Free
Insects love to make their homes in wooden pergolas. Termites, carpenter ants, and other bugs can eat away at the structure, making it weak. But you can keep them away with a few smart steps.
- Use bug-resistant wood like cedar or redwood.
- Apply a protective insect-repellent coating.
- Keep the area around the pergola clean and free of debris.
Take Care of Climbing Plants
Climbing plants like ivy, wisteria, or roses add charm to a pergola. But they can also cause damage if they grow too wild.
- Trim vines regularly so they do not become too heavy.
- Avoid letting roots or branches grow into cracks.
- Make sure plants are not trapping moisture against the wood.
With proper care, your pergola and plants can thrive together beautifully.
Prepare for the Seasons
Different weather conditions can take a toll on your pergola. Preparing for the seasons helps protect the grass from harsh elements.
- In winter, remove snow buildup to prevent weight damage.
- In rainy seasons, check for leaks or water pooling.
- In hot weather, apply UV protection to prevent fading. There are various UV protection products available in the market, such as UV-resistant sealants and paints. These products form a barrier against the sun’s harmful rays, preserving the color and appearance of your pergola.
Adjusting your care routine based on the season keeps your pergola looking fresh all year long.
